Sky Talk package – a subscribers warning

Sky TV offers a nice sounding package for Sky subscribers called Sky Talk, for a nominal monthly payment you can call 30 or so international destinations free of charge – up to 1 hour talk, then hang up and dial again to avoid extra charges.

There’s a problem with Sky Talk they don’t tell you about though. If you ever want to cancel your Sky TV package, firstly you lose the Sky Talk option, BUT, most important you may well find your phone has been immobilised. You can’t make any calls on your phone. Even if you have made arrangements with another phone supplier like BT, you will find every time you try to make a call you will get a pre recorded voice from Sky talk saying your service has been restricted. Your phone is useless, you can’t make any calls out except to Sky TV.

So you then call SKY TV, to complain. There you will receive no help, except sympathy. This is what has happened to me, a loyal Sky subscriber for years, up to date with all payments, stuck with a useless phone because Sky Talk have grabbed the phone line and disabled it.

So take this warning, subscribe to Sky Talk by all means, but watch it if you ever want to cancel.
